However in Hedex library the FASTRETURNTOLTESWITCH about six switches as mentioned below:

  1. PERFENH_PS_FAST_RETURN_LTE_SWITCH: Whether the BSC6900 releases the RRC connection when a CS fallback UE keeps a PS connection after terminating the CS service.
    When this switch is turned on, the BSC6900 releases the RRC connection by sending to a UE an RRC CONNECTION RELEASE message that carries the information about UE-supported LTE frequencies if the UE keeps the PS connection after terminating the CS service. When this switch is turned off, the BSC6900 does not release the RRC connection if a CS fallback UE keeps the PS connection after terminating the CS service.

  2. HO_UMTS_TO_LTE_FAST_RETURN_SWITCH: Whether the information about frequencies of neighboring LTE cells is carried in the RRC CONNECTION RELEASE message the BSC6900 sends to a CS fallback UE in a UMTS cell for RRC connection release. This parameter is configured at the cell. When this switch is turned on, the information about UE-supported frequencies of neighboring LTE cells is carried in the RRC CONNECTION RELEASE message. When this switch is turned off, the information about UE-supported frequencies of neighboring LTE cells is not carried in the RRC CONNECTION RELEASE message.

  3. HO_SRVCC_FAST_RETURN_TO_LTE_SWITCH: Whether to trigger measurement-based UMTS-to-LTE fast return for an SRVCC UE whose CS service has been released in the UMTS network. SRVCC is short for single radio voice call continuity.When this switch is set to ON, measurement-based UMTS-to-LTE fast return can be triggered for an SRVCC UE whose CS service has been released in the UMTS network. When this switch is set to OFF, measurement-based UMTS-to-LTE fast return cannot be triggered for an SRVCC UE whose CS service has been released in the UMTS network.

  4. HO_CSFB_BASED_MEAS_FAST_RETURN_SWITCH: Whether the RNC triggers the measurement-based UMTS-to-LTE fast return for CSFB UEs after their voice services are released in a cell on the UMTS network. When this switch is turned on and the UE supports LTE measurement, the UE triggers an LTE measurement after its voice service is complete. After the RNC receives the measurement report, the RNC decides whether to trigger a U2L fast return based on the measurement result. When this switch is turned off, the RNC can perform only a blind fast return for the UE.

  5. HO_CSFB_BASED_RSCP_FAST_RETURN_SWITCH: Whether the RNC triggers the UMTS-to-LTE fast return for CSFB UEs based on the RSCP of the best cell after their voice services are released in a cell on the UMTS network. When this switch is turned on, the RNC sends a periodic intra-frequency measurement control message to the UE, instructing the UE to measure the RSCP of the best cell. If the RSCP of the best cell reported by the UE is equal to or greater than the value of U2LNCovRscpThd, the RNC will trigger a blind fast return. Otherwise, the RNC will not trigger the blind fast return. When this switch is turned off, the RNC does not send the UE the periodic intra-frequency measurement control message instructing the UE to measure the RSCP of the best cell.

  6. HO_CSFB_BASED_GRID_FAST_RETURN_SWITCH: Whether virtual grid-based CSFB fast return takes effect.
    When this switch is turned on, virtual grid-based CSFB fast return takes effect.
    When this switch is turned off, virtual grid-based CSFB fast return does not take effect.
